Research On Industrial Transformation And Upgrading In Jiangsu Province Under Low Carbon Economy

Climate and energy resources are indispensable external conditions for human survival and development. However, with the continuous expansion of production and living activities of hum an society, the use of energy resources,especially the fossil energy resources is increasing as well as a lot more greenhouse gas emissions. It triggers global wanning and energy crisis, seriously af fecting the safety of human life and production activities and arousing global concern. From "Un ited Nations Framework Convention on Climate Change","Kyoto Protocol", to "Copenhagen Ac cord", people around the world are actively coping with climate change and energy crisis. The g reen economic development model-low carbon economy, with low energy consumption, low po llution, low emissions and high efficacy, high efficiency, high profit as its main feature, with ene rgy technology innovation and institutional innovation as its core, with improving energy efficie ncy and reducing greenhouse gas emissions to achieve sustainable development of mankind as it s goal, is undoubtedly the most effective way to solve the energy crisis and global warming issue s. China, the world’s second largest energy consumer and the first in carbon dioxide emissions, fa ces enormous pressure in reducing emissions. As Jiangsu Province is a pioneer of China’s econo mic boom, its energy problems and carbon emissions are inevitablesevere,it faces the difficult task of energy conservation and emissions reduction.The industry is the leading force in promoting the economic development of Jiangsu Province, which leads to rising carbon emission s. Therefore, the industry in Jiangsu Province promotes rapid economic development and also br ings tremendous pressure, which is the key to achieving energy saving.This article develops a series of studies on the transformation and upgrading of industry in Jiangsu Province in this context. In reference to domestic and foreign scholars relevant theories and research achievements on energy consumption.carbon emissions, industrial structure adjustment,this paper uses the descriptive statistics analysis method to analyze the current situation of industrial development,energy consumption and carbon emissions of jiangsu province.While teasing out the factors that influencing industrial carbon emissions,combind with relevant data from1995to2011,established econometric models for time series empirical a nalysis. The results show that the expansion of the industrial economy, the incredibly high ratio o f high-energy-consuming products export, the proportion of light and heavy industries would res ult in increasing carbon emissions on the objective; while the more clean energy such as oil and natural gas, and industries technical level increase in the share of the energy consumption structu re, helping to reduce carbon emissions. Finally, according to the related research and conclusion of this paper, this paper put forward the following suggestions for jiangsu province to realize the industrial transformation and upgrading, and realize the sustainable development of economic and social:making scientific planning of industrial development to promote upgrading of the industrial structure; adjusting the industrial energy consumption structure to improve energy efficiency; controlling the export of energy intensive industrial products to optimize the structure of export trade; to speed up the establishment and startting of the carbon trading platform to promote the formation of low carbon policy mechanism; to increase the investment in science and technology to establish a technology innovation system that the enterprise as the main body.
